Biography of Upendra Yadav

Upendra Yadav, born on October 8, 1996, in Kanpur, Uttar Pradesh, India, is a talented cricketer who has gradually made his mark in the realm of Indian cricket. Known for his skills as a wicketkeeper batter, Yadav has showcased his talents in various domestic formats and has represented the national team in International Twenty20 (T20) matches. With a right-handed batting style complemented by right-arm off-spin bowling, Yadav has been a versatile addition to any cricketing setup.

Domestic Career and Debut

Yadav's professional cricket journey began when he made his debut in domestic cricket. His first significant appearance was for Uttar Pradesh in the Ranji Trophy during the 2017-2018 season. In his initial matches, Yadav showcased his skills as a reliable wicketkeeper and a solid middle-order batsman. His performances in the domestic circuit caught the attention of selectors and cricket aficionados alike, paving the way for further opportunities.

In the following years, Yadav continued to excel in domestic competitions, including the Vijay Hazare Trophy and Syed Mushtaq Ali Trophy. His ability to score runs while also contributing behind the stumps solidified his reputation in the Indian domestic cricketing landscape.
